Agro-morphological characterization of yellow passion fruit (Passiflora edulis f. flavicarpa Degener) reveals elite genotypes for a breeding program in Colombia

Abstract: Yellow passion fruit cultivation in Colombia lacks detailed genetic studies that allow the establishment of intraspecific variability as a basis for a breeding program. The aim of this research was to establish the genetic relationships among accessions of different geographic origins through an agro-morphological characterization. This research was carried out in the municipality of Palestina (Caldas) at the Luker farm located at 1050 m a.s.l. Fifty-two accessions from Colombia (47), Ecuador (3), Brazil (1), … Show more
